Bishop Gennaro is the patron saint of Naples, and thus the subject of numerous works from that city’s rich school of painting. He was bishop of Benevento during the Diocletianic Persecution in the third century AD. While visiting Pozzuoli, north of the Gulf of Naples, Gennaro was taken prisoner and tortured in various ways, miraculously emerging unscathed. Finally, he was decapitated and buried there.
